Drainage should be handled before the pretty work.
Water issues can ruin patios, walls, and planting. We look at slope, downspouts, clay soil, low spots, and where water needs to move before finishes go in.
Cincinnati properties often deal with slope, clay soils, and heavy rain. We shape water movement before finishes go in so the space performs after storms and freeze-thaw cycles.
Before recommending a fix, we look at where water starts, where it collects, where it can safely go, and what finished work needs to be protected.
- Surface grading
- French drains
- Downspout and water routing
